What they do

A Psychiatry Nurse Practitioner provides mental health and nursing care to patients with psychiatric disorders, medical organic brain disorders or substance abuse problems. Diagnoses mental illness, develops treatment plans and prescribes medications. Teaches patient's family about the patient's condition. Works at hospitals with dedicated mental health unit, fully dedicated psychiatric hospital or in independent practice working from nursing homes and physicians' offices.

Responsibilities Conduct thorough psychiatric evaluations, including mental status examinations and behavioral assessments for patients of all ages. Prescribe and manage medications within collaborative practice agreements, adhering to HIPAA regulations and DEA guidelines. Develop personalized treatment plans that incorporate psychotherapy, medication management, and other therapeutic interventions. Collaborate closely with physicians, therapists, social workers, and other healthcare providers to coordinate comprehensive patient care. Utilize electronic health record (EHR) systems such as Epic or eClinicalWorks for accurate documentation of patient encounters and treatment progress. Provide telehealth services to expand access to mental health care for remote or underserved populations. Educate patients and their families on mental health conditions, medication use, lifestyle modifications, and coping strategies to promote recovery and resilience. Qualifications Valid state licensure as a Nurse Practitioner with certification in Psychiatry or Mental Health Nursing. Proven experience working with behavioral health patients across diverse settings such as hospitals, outpatient clinics, or assisted living facilities. Strong knowledge of psychiatric medications, psychopharmacology, and clinical research methodologies. Familiarity with EMR/EHR systems like Athenahealth or Cerner for efficient medical documentation. Experience in acute care environments such as ICU or emergency medicine is highly desirable. Ability to perform physical examinations, vital signs assessment, medication administration, and diagnostic evaluations confidently. Excellent communication skills for client education, case management, and interdisciplinary collaboration.
